
Bachelor of Science in Manufacturing Management
University of Minnesota, Crookston
Description
This online Bachelor of Science in Manufacturing Management degree program from the University of Minnesota, Crookston was designed to overlay a two year technical college degree with management-related coursework, providing opportunities for working adults to advance to management and supervisory positions.
As a student in this online Manufacturing Management degree program, individuals will work with a number of experts as they learn to establish a quality control department and train staff to meet quality audits, as well asset up acceptance sampling and inspection procedures.
Topics addressed by the online manufacturing management courses, include:
- Composition
- Microeconomics
- College Algebra
- Elementary Statistics
- Public Speaking
- Principles of Accounting
- Applied Engineering Principles
- Quality Management Systems
- Principles of Management
- Supervision and Leadership
- Principles of Marketing
Graduates will be able to supervise a manufacturing process, manage human and mechanical resources within budgetary constraints, and assure product quality.
